I did testing on this. The hosts file seems to be enough:
- Start -> "notepad" (do not press ENTER key)
- Right-click on Notepad program -> Run as Administrator
- File -> Open -> %systemroot%\system32\drivers\etc\hosts
- Add these 3 lines to the file:
# Prevent XCOM Phone Home 127.0.0.1 prod.xcom.firaxis.com 127.0.0.1 65.118.245.165
- Save the file
No need to reboot even, at least on Windows 7.
I tested by changing the cost of Medikits to $1 and changing the assault rifle to not require ammo. After this change, I was able to leave Steam ONLINE and the game still used by changes. I verified in the log file that the game only seems to get updates via the server above. It does NOT appear to get updates through Steam.
